Understanding Dog Bite Laws in Florida

In Florida, dog owners are held strictly liable for injuries caused by their pets, even if the dog had no previous history of aggression or violence. The law mandates that victims of dog bites do not need to prove negligence—they must only establish that the bite occurred and resulted in injury. It's crucial to understand these statutes to ensure you can assert your rights effectively in the aftermath of an incident.

Common Injuries from Dog Bites

Dog bites can result in a wide range of injuries, from minor cuts and bruises to more serious conditions such as infections, nerve damage, and scarring. Psychological trauma, including anxiety and fear from the attack, can also affect victims long after the physical wounds have healed. Understanding the full extent of your injuries is vital to build a strong case.

Steps to Take After a Dog Bite Incident

  1. Seek Immediate Medical Attention: Documenting your injuries through a medical professional is critical.
  2. Report the Incident: Notify local animal control or the police to have the incident officially recorded.
  3. Gather Information: Collect contact information from the dog owner and any witnesses.
  4. Contact a Lawyer: A legal professional can help assess your case and guide you through the legal process.
